Installing CertPay 5 on Windows Vista
Q) Are there any issues installing CertPay Wizard v5 on Windows Vista?
A) There are two issues that are due to the use of InstallShield to create the setup program.
The first one is that a prerequisite for CertPay is SQL Server 2005. Windows Vista requires Service Pack 2 of this program. SP2 can be installed after SP1 is downloaded and installed by CertPay or you can download SP2 and install it by clicking here.
The second issue is that InstallShield can not extract files within the Windows folder. A screenshot is shown below.
If this occurs on your computer, click OK. You will then be asked to specify the location of the installation package as shown below.
On the machine used here for testing, the location of the installation package was c:\doctemp\edoc0. Specify that location and click OK to continue the installation.
This issue can be avoided by disabling User Account Control (UAC) before installing CertPay, then enabling UAC afterwards.
